Check the parcel first
Parcel facts, property characteristics, and ownership details should be checked before a homeowner assumes the problem is only the tax bill itself.
Use the board process
Franklin County’s Board of Revision is the public process homeowners should compare against when evaluating any appeal service.
Build evidence, not just objections
Comparable sales, record accuracy, and property-specific condition issues usually matter more than generic frustration with a high bill.
Franklin County workflow
- Confirm the parcel facts and assessed value first.
- Check the current filing instructions with the Board of Revision.
- Collect evidence that speaks directly to value, not just to payment strain.
- Keep the case tied to the property, the county record, and the timeline in effect for that filing cycle.
